146. Deputy Jonathan O'Brien as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Justice and Equality the resources allocated to the Probation Service during each of the past seven years; and the number of persons the service worked with during each of those years. [9920/17]
Answer
Tánaiste and Minister for Justice and Equality (Deputy Frances Fitzgerald): The following table sets out the Probation Service's budget and the number of offenders that it dealt with in the community for the years 2011 to 2017.
| Year | Budget Provision €000 |
Number of offenders dealt with in the community |
| 2017 | €46,245 | --- |
| 2016 | €38,963 | 14,900* |
| 2015 | €38,326 | 14,927 |
| 2014 | €37,295 | 15,134 |
| 2013 | €38,119 | 15,984 |
| 2012 | €40,171 | 15,080 |
| 2011 | €41,253 | 14,845 |
*Note this is an estimated figure, the final figure will be published in the Probation Service's 2016 Annual Report in the coming months.
